A driving conviction carries either a Fixed Penalty Notice (a fine) or a summons to court – depending on the offence or a driving ban. The most common driving offences are speeding, drink driving and using a mobile device whilst at the wheel. Also, driving without insurance is another common driving offence.

Competitive IN10 Insurance … WebDriving without insurance is not an imprisonable offence in itself, so a conviction will not appear on a criminal record. However, if you’re convicted of driving without insurance, an IN10 endorsement will remain on your driving licence for four years - and you’ll need to disclose it to insurance providers for a further year.
